Description

Eugene Charniak presents an accessible resource that immerses readers in the fundamentals of deep learning through hands-on projects. This approach not only demystifies complex concepts but also fosters a practical understanding of how deep learning techniques are applied in real-world scenarios.

The book is structured to gradually introduce readers to essential principles while encouraging experimentation. Each project is designed to build confidence and skills, making the learning process engaging and effective. Charniak's clear explanations and emphasis on practical application allow beginners to grasp challenging topics without feeling overwhelmed.

By combining theoretical knowledge with actionable tasks, this guide offers a valuable pathway for those eager to explore the dynamic field of deep learning. It's an indispensable tool for students, professionals, or anyone intrigued by the potential of machine learning technologies.
